Ouat Entertainment, founded in 2005, has established itself as a notable player in the casual gaming sector, particularly focusing on hidden object games and family-friendly titles. The studio gained recognition with the launch of "Pure Hidden," which showcased their ability to create engaging and visually appealing experiences. Over the years, Ouat has expanded its portfolio, including the development of "Kirikou," based on the beloved animated film, and "Totally Spies! Totally Party," which capitalized on the popularity of the animated series.
